General Meaning
A radiant child rides a white horse beneath a blazing sun, arms outstretched in pure delight — there is no ambivalence here, no shadow, no asterisk on the joy. The Sun is the most unambiguously positive card in the tarot deck, the full, abundant light that dissolves confusion and illuminates everything it touches. Where The Moon created uncertainty and fear, The Sun brings clarity, confidence, and the simple, direct experience of life feeling good. This is the card of vitality, of innocent happiness, of success that comes not from struggle but from alignment — from being so fully yourself that life cannot help but say yes to you.
↑ Upright Meanings
💕 Love
The Sun in love is an extraordinary blessing — this is the card of joy in relationship, of love that is warm, open, and undefended, of two people who genuinely delight in each other. If you are seeking love, The Sun is among the best possible cards, promising that what is coming is bright and genuine. In existing partnerships, this is a period of warmth, ease, playfulness, and deep gratitude for each other.
💼 Career
Professionally, The Sun brings success, recognition, and the pleasure of work that is genuinely satisfying. This is a time when your talents and contributions are visible and appreciated, when projects succeed, and when professional confidence comes easily. Leadership roles, public visibility, creative work, and any endeavor that requires your full and radiant self are all especially well-starred.

↓ Reversed Meanings
📖 General (Reversed)
The Sun reversed does not negate its energy — it is still one of the more positive cards, even in reversal. It suggests that the joy and clarity of the upright Sun are present but temporarily blocked, dimmed, or harder to access. There may be a tendency toward excessive optimism or unrealistic confidence that needs tempering, or something is preventing you from fully experiencing the warmth and success that are genuinely available to you.
💕 Love
Reversed in love, The Sun can indicate that the joy and ease in a relationship have become temporarily obscured — perhaps by external pressures, miscommunication, or a period of difficulty that both partners are navigating. The warmth is still there underneath; reconnect with what first brought you together and with the simple pleasures of being in each other's company.
💼 Career
Career-wise, The Sun reversed suggests that success is present but not fully realized — or that an over-confidence or inflated sense of capability is leading to over-commitment, careless decisions, or an inability to hear useful feedback. Tempering enthusiasm with realism, and confidence with genuine humility, will help you make better use of the strong energy available.
